Daily Mail A show in Liuyang, China featuring 15,947 drones has set a new Guinness World Record for the largest

AI Article: Perplexity Google Lens
Daily Mail

A show in Liuyang, China featuring 15,947 drones has set a new Guinness World Record for the largest
Posted by Fast News in Default Category 1 hour, 52 minutes ago  ·  Public

Comments (0)

New Videos

AI Article